Lincoln - Sophomore I-back Tre Bryant erupted for a career-high 192 yards to help carry the Nebraska football team to a 43-36 win over Arkansas State in Saturday night's 2017 season opener at Memorial Stadium.
Bryant, whose previous career highs were 13 carries for 56 yards, powered his way to 78 yards in a wild first half, before helping the Huskers take gain control of the game with 114 yards and a touchdown on 18 second-half carries.
Bryant's big night in the backfield in his first career start, helped make a winner of quarterback Tanner Lee in his first game as a Husker.
